Le Roi d’Ys

Opera in three acts and five tableaux, first performed at the Opéra-Comique (salle du Théâtre-Lyrique) on 7 May 1888.

Édouard Lalo was long excluded from the operatic stage, and had to wait until he was sixty-five for a chance to shine there. But his first venture proved to be a success: Le Roi d’Ys was immediately hailed as a masterpiece. Set in medieval Brittany, the opera recounts the last hours of the legendary city of Ys.
